Overview

Land-saving burial encompasses practices like vertical burial structures, tree-pod interments, and shared memorial spaces, reducing land use by up to 70% compared to traditional graves. Originating in densely populated Asian cities like Hong Kong and Tokyo, it now gains global traction as municipalities face land shortages. These methods align with green burial movements, emphasizing biodegradability and minimal environmental impact. Governments often incentivize such practices through subsidies or streamlined permits. For instance, China’s ‘Ecological Burial Promotion Policy’ mandates land-saving options in urban planning. Cultural adaptation remains critical, with designs incorporating local aesthetics and rituals to ensure public acceptance.

Key Features

Space optimization defines land-saving burial, with multi-level columbariums housing thousands of urns in a single building footprint. Modular designs allow expansion, while smart systems (e.g., QR-code memorials) enhance visitor management. Materials range from recycled steel for niches to plantable urns made of compressed organic compounds. Environmental benefits include reduced soil disruption and carbon emissions. A single vertical cemetery saves approximately 10 acres of land annually. Hybrid models, like ‘memorial forests,’ combine burial with urban green spaces, serving dual civic and ecological functions. Durability standards ensure structures withstand weather and seismic activity where applicable.

Application Areas

Metropolitan areas with limited land resources are primary adopters. Singapore’s Choa Chu Kang Columbarium exemplifies high-density solutions, while European cities like Berlin integrate burial gardens into public parks. Religious institutions also adopt these methods; Japan’s Ruriden Buddhist temple uses LED-lit glass ossuaries. Commercial applications include private memorial parks offering premium eco-burial plots. Real estate developers collaborate with funeral providers to incorporate burial spaces into mixed-use projects. Disaster-prone regions utilize compact burial systems for efficient mass interment during crises, complying with WHO sanitary guidelines.

Precautions

Legal compliance is paramount. In the EU, burial density and formaldehyde use are regulated under environmental directives. Operators must conduct soil tests for biodegradable urn sites to prevent groundwater contamination. Cultural consultations are essential—for example, Islamic burials often require specific body orientation. Maintenance demands differ by method: vertical structures need elevator upkeep, while natural burial sites require landscaping. Transparent pricing models prevent public disputes; Shanghai’s municipal cemeteries publish tiered pricing for niches ($500–$5,000) based on height and accessibility.

B2B Procurement Guide

Procure from certified suppliers meeting ISO 9001 (quality management) and ISO 14001 (environmental standards). For columbariums, prioritize fire-resistant materials like reinforced concrete. Biodegradable urn vendors should provide decomposition rate certifications (e.g., 6–24 months). Bulk purchasing reduces costs: a 10,000-niche columbarium project averages $1.5M–$3M. Include lifecycle costs—annual maintenance averages 2–5% of construction expenses. Negotiate with local governments for zoning concessions; some offer tax breaks for green burial infrastructure. Pilot projects with community feedback minimize post-installation redesigns.
